Property Summary: 681 Castlebury Meadows Drive
Section 1: Key Characteristics & Appeal
This home presents a compelling blend of modern build quality and above-average space for its area. Built in 2017, it is a relatively new property that ranks within the top 5% of homes citywide for its age, suggesting lower immediate maintenance costs and modern building standards. With 1,832 sqft of living space, it offers more room than most Winnipeg homes and is competitively sized within its North Inkster Industrial neighbourhood. The 4,725 sqft lot provides a generous outdoor space for the area.
The primary appeal lies in its strong value positioning. The home’s assessed value of $590,000 places it consistently in the top 15-20% of comparable properties at every geographic level—from its own street to the entire city. This indicates a perceived premium above the norm, which could be attributed to its size, condition, and newer construction. The data suggests you are paying for a home that stands out in its peer group.
This property would suit buyers looking for a move-in ready, modern home in Winnipeg who prioritize space and a newer build without venturing into the luxury market. It’s ideal for someone who values statistical performance—a home that metrics show is larger, newer, and assessed higher than many of its neighbours and city-wide counterparts. It may also attract buyers who see the established, above-average assessment as a marker of stability.
Section 2: Frequently Asked Questions
1. How does the assessed value relate to the likely selling price?
The assessed value of $590,000 is for municipal tax purposes and is based on a mass appraisal. While it’s a strong indicator and places this home well above local averages, the actual market price can be influenced by current conditions, interior updates, and specific buyer demand.
2. The home sold in 2017. What does that history tell me?
It was last purchased when it was newly built. The sale price then was in the CA$350k–400k range. This provides a baseline for its appreciation over the past nine years, which appears significant given the current assessment.
3. Is the lot size a pro or a con?
It depends on your priorities. The lot is above average for the immediate area and neighbourhood, which is a plus for outdoor space. However, it is around the city-wide average, so if comparing to older neighbourhoods with larger lots, it may seem standard.
4. What does the "North Inkster Industrial" neighbourhood name imply?
This typically designates a newer suburban development area. The "Industrial" in the name is often a historical planning district designation and does not mean the home is adjacent to factories. It generally indicates a community of modern, residential subdivisions.
